We are a well-established specialist contractor within the construction industry, delivering services including steeplejack and specialist access, lightning protection and electrical earthing, as well as structural maintenance and waterproofing across the UK.
Due to continued growth, we are looking to recruit Lightning Protection & Earthing Engineers, Test Engineers, and Adult Learners from related industries who are keen to retrain and develop their careers within a highly skilled and supportive team.
The Role
You will be involved in the installation, testing, inspection, and maintenance of lightning protection and earthing systems across a range of sites nationwide.
